Understanding the Role of Angels
Angels are spiritual beings created by God, serving various roles in the heavenly hierarchy. Here are some key aspects of angels as portrayed in the Bible:
- Messengers of God: Angels are often sent to deliver messages, as seen in the Annunciation, when the angel Gabriel informed Mary of her divine pregnancy (Luke 1:26-38).
- Guides and Protectors: Many scriptures emphasize their protective roles, often described as guardians over God's people.
- Worshippers of God: Angels are seen in worship, glorifying and praising God continuously.

Bible Verses Highlighting Guardian Angels
1. Psalm 91:11-12
"For He will command His angels concerning you to guard you in all your ways; they will lift you up in their hands so that you will not strike your foot against a stone."
This verse is a powerful reminder of the protective role angels play in our lives. It assures us that we are never alone; God's angels watch over us, ensuring our safety and well-being.
2. Matthew 18:10
"See that you do not despise one of these little ones. For I tell you that their angels in heaven always see the face of my Father in heaven."
Here, Jesus emphasizes the importance of children and their guardian angels. This verse is reassuring for parents, reminding them that their children have divine protection and attention from the heavens.
3. Hebrews 1:14
"Are not all angels ministering spirits sent to serve those who will inherit salvation?"
This verse highlights the role of angels as our servants and helpers, particularly for those who believe in Christ. It suggests that angels are tasked with ministering to the needs of the faithful.
4. Psalm 34:7
"The angel of the Lord encamps around those who fear him, and he delivers them."
This passage affirms the idea that angels provide a protective shield around those who honor and respect God. It’s a powerful promise that reminds believers of the divine security present in their lives.
5. Exodus 23:20
"See, I am sending an angel ahead of you to guard you along the way and to bring you to the place I have prepared."
In this verse, God speaks to the Israelites about leading them safely, further illustrating angels’ guiding and guarding roles. This reflects God’s commitment to leading and protecting His people.
